Diabetes Foot Services in the Bayside Area
Diabetes is one of the leading causes of foot complications in the Australian healthcare system. Poorly managed diabetes can lead to reduced blood flow and sensation of the foot and lower limb, and if not managed appropriately can lead to a loss of sensation and reduced blood flow to the feet and further complications such as diabetic foot ulcers or amputation.
As such, establishing a line of communication with your podiatrist and attending a clinic for regular skin and nail care, foot health assessment and patient-centred management is important.
